International Steering Committee for Global Mapping (ISCGM) and Geographical Survey Institute (GSI) host Global Mapping Forum 2008 in Tokyo, Japan.

This Forum, in commemoration of the release of Global Map Version 1 that covers the whole land area of the earth, aims at exchanging of opinions and information between data providers and users on the application of Global Map data to the investigations and researches of global environment issues and their related fields.

Global Mapping Forum 2008 is the fifth international forum for Global Mapping.
The past forums are held as follows:
1997 Gifu City, Japan
1998 Sioux Falls, South Dakota, USA
2000 Hiroshima City, Japan
2003 Ginowan City, Okinawa, Japan
